Audit Checklist — Item 7: Template Rendering Performance

Contractor note: confirm the Slatebird template engine renders the standard benchmark suite under 120 ms per page, with partial caching enabled. Record p95 timings in the audit sheet and flag any template exceeding budget. Do not tune cache settings yourself; changes require approval from the owner identified below.

approver of bagaf-hahif = Casok Jorael Quenys Rusdor

Changed defaults in Splitfork, our assignment service. Bucketing now uses sticky hashing per account instead of per session, and the holdout slice grew from 2% to 5%. Callers relying on session-level reassignment must opt in explicitly. Review the diff against the new baseline; the updated default configuration is listed below.

config for tagep-kajof:
[casir]
port = 6379
region = south-1
host = casir.paliqdyn.example
team = tamax
timeout_ms = 250
retries = 2

### Ticket #2209 — Markdown pipeline double-escapes inline code

The Pellwright markdown renderer escapes backtick spans twice when a document passes through both the sanitizer and the highlighter stages. Result: literal HTML entities appear inside code spans. Likely introduced when the sanitizer moved ahead of tokenization. Fix should ensure escaping happens exactly once, post-highlight. The regression first appeared in the build identified by the token below.

pipeline stamp: htk4_ae36